A British family recently journeyed on India’s Vande Bharat Express and shared their experience online. Their trip, lasting four hours, was filled with beautiful views and tasty snacks. The couple expressed delight at the onboard food, which included a meal tray featuring diet mixtures, caramel popcorn, and ginger tea.
They mentioned the tickets cost around £11 each for the whole family, a price that includes food. This prompted laughter and excitement, especially when they tried out the ginger tea. One family member remarked how nice it smelled, while someone else jokingly noted the snacks were aimed at being healthy.
Their video has gained a lot of traction, with over 1.4 million views and numerous positive comments. Viewers praised the family for shining a light on India, often overshadowed by negative news. Many expressed appreciation for their honest review, noting that it’s refreshing to hear good things about the country.
The Vande Bharat Express, built at the Integral Coach Factory in Chennai, is a shining example of modern Indian train technology. It includes high-end safety features, such as an automatic braking system named ‘Kavach,’ which stops the train if another train is detected on the same track. This aligns with India’s broader goal to modernize its rail services, offering travelers various classes for their comfort.
This train isn’t just a mode of transportation; it symbolizes India’s push for advanced, efficient travel. According to recent statistics, rail travel in India is not only growing rapidly but also becoming more accessible to tourists, thanks in part to initiatives like the Vande Bharat Express.
